I have a wordpress website which used WooCommerce and the YITH Gift Cards plugin (free version). On the checkout page, when a user applies a coupon (Gift Card), the remaining balance is correctly reduced by the value of the gift card. There are two issues however: When the user attempts to add a second gift card, the first one seems to be removed. How can I allow users to apply multiple gift cards to an order on the checkout? Once a user has applied a gift card, it’s value is reduced even if the order is not placed. If you remove the gift card or abandon the purchase, the original value of the gift card should be restored. How can I ensure that the value of the gift card is only reduced when the order is placed? An observation is that although I only have the free version of this plugin, there is no additional place to enter the gift card, so I am using the standard WooCommerce ‘Apply Coupon’ box. I am unsure if this is correct but I cannot find any way to make a special Gift Card box appear. Other details: PHP version: 7.4.33 WordPress version: 6.9 YITH Gift Cards Version: 4.29.0 I have tried everything to get this to work, so any help would be greatly appreciated. Many thanks!!
